Yandex Music 5.93.1, published by Yandex Music and now in its 93rd iterative release, belongs to the multimedia/online music streaming category and functions as a Windows-native client for the Russian cloud-based platform of the same name. The application’s primary purpose is to deliver on-demand access to a multimillion-track library of songs and podcasts, coupling the catalog with a proprietary machine-learning recommendation engine that continuously refines personal mixes, daily playlists, and genre-specific radio stations for each listener. Typical use cases range from background playback during work or study sessions to discovering regional artists through location-aware charts, caching albums for offline listening on commuter routes, and synchronizing playlists across Android, iOS, and web sessions when a user switches devices. The client supports lossy streaming up to 320 kbps AAC, gapless playback, lyrics display, and parental controls, while also integrating with Yandex Station smart speakers and Alice voice assistant for hands-free operation. Version 5.93.1 refines buffer management for slower connections, updates the podcast episode timeline, and patches minor UI rendering issues reported in prior builds.
